What the college says
The Level 3 Certificate in Care and Management of Diabetes aims to increase understanding and awareness of diabetes. There are 3.6 million people in the UK that have been diagnosed with diabetes, and it is estimated that 46% of people who are living with diabetes are undiagnosed. Although diabetes can be life changing, many cases of diabetes can be managed by simple lifestyle changes. This course is ideal for those working in the health and social care sector, as well as those who have or care for those with diabetes.
What you need to get on
There are no previous qualifications required to complete this qualification. This is an entry level qualification aimed to build your skills and knowledge.
